- [ ] **Step 7: Breaker override escrow.** After sealing the signing keys for the Tallgrove upstream API circuit breaker, confirm the support team can force the breaker open during a full outage. The override bundle lives in the sealed escrow drawer and is useless without its unlock phrase. Two ceremony witnesses must initial this step before proceeding. The escrow bundle is decrypted with the recovery passphrase that follows.

vault phrase of kahip-kahop = holath-quenmir

**Ticket: Migrate larkspur-gateway to hermetic builds**

New folks: larkspur-gateway still builds on the legacy Tinderbox scripts with unpinned system deps. Goal is full migration to the Quarrel hermetic toolchain. Vendored libs are inventoried; remaining blockers are the codegen step and two impure tests. Do not add new deps to the old path. Last known-good hermetic build is noted below.

pipeline stamp: htk4_ae36

Ticket #88: Badge system migration, night-shift notice. Over the weekend, Fenwick Row is moving from the old Keystone readers to the new Ardale panels. Night staff should expect the lift lobby readers to be offline between 01:00 and 04:00 on Saturday. During this window, use the stairwell doors only, and log every entry in the paper register at the guard desk. Legacy badges will stop working once the cutover completes. Until your replacement badge arrives, the night crew should use the interim code below.

door code, yageg-yagap: bdg-DNN-9

**Ticket PROC-2291: Expired creds on the exam-proctoring queue**

Hey, flagging this for security review. The worker that drains the Invigilo proctoring queue started throwing 401s around midnight — turns out the consumer key lapsed because it wasn't enrolled in the Keybarrow auto-rotation job. I minted a replacement this morning, scoped read-only to the queue, 90-day expiry, and enrolled it properly this time. Old key is already revoked. For verification, here's the new key.

service key, yadug-bajog: zpat3_pou